Default 2009 FLHTPI upgrades

I have been reviewing performance upgrades for my 103" bike. I have recently installed a reinhart 2:1, SE air cleaner and done 3 TTS V-tunes. The bike is much better than before. However, I have plans to install a 30 tooth trans sprocket, mainly to use 6th gear more here in Canada (speed limit 60mph, high fines and loss of licence if 30 mph over!). I would like to install cams, based on 95% solo riding with rider plus equipment at, say 240 lbs. I have seen calculators that convert cam timing into RPM 'sweet spot' or turn on rpm used for cam selection for riding style choice. My questions are:
1. Is there a link to a harley trans ratio vs. speed calculator?
2. can I go with a cam more to the right torque-wise (6%?) with the 30 tooth?
3. cam choice based on above mods plus 30 tooth sprocket? intake close of 42 degrees sounds good?
